Senior Associate Director – Corporate Communications

Location: London (hybrid)

Salary: £80K – £105K + bonus + benefits



All potential candidates should read through the following details of this job with care before making an application.

My client, one of the world’s most well-known PR & Communications firms, is continuing to invest in the growth of its corporate communications offering and is looking to hire a Senior Associate Director to play a key role in shaping its next phase.


This is a high-impact position for someone who wants to step into a senior leadership role with real influence; supporting the direction of the corporate practice while remaining close to the work, the clients, and the team.


The Opportunity

You’ll act as a senior strategic partner to clients while helping to lead a high-performing team across a portfolio of global brands. The work spans corporate storytelling, executive positioning, reputation management and sustainability communications - delivered in a way that goes beyond traditional channels.


This team is focused on evolving corporate communications into something more engaging, culturally relevant and proactive and you’ll be part of driving that shift.


What You’ll Be Responsible For

  • Leading day-to-day strategic delivery across key accounts, ensuring work is impactful, insight-led and commercially sound
  • Acting as a trusted advisor to clients, providing counsel on reputation, risk and opportunity
  • Supporting business growth through organic account development and contributing to new business pitches
  • Playing a key role in pitch processes, from shaping ideas through to delivery
  • Helping to oversee team structure, workflow and output quality across accounts
  • Contributing to the external profile and positioning of the corporate practice

Leadership & Team

You’ll play an important role in leading and developing the team, including:

  • Mentoring and supporting junior and mid-level team members
  • Helping to create a positive, high-performance team environment
  • Maintaining strong standards across all output, from strategy through to execution
  • Supporting senior leadership in addressing challenges and driving team effectiveness

Commercial & Operational Contribution

  • Supporting account financials, including forecasting and revenue tracking
  • Working with senior leadership on budgeting and resource planning
  • Using commercial insight to identify opportunities for account growth


Key Skills

  • Strong experience in corporate communications within an agency environment, ideally working with well known global brands
  • A track record of contributing to client strategy and delivering impactful campaigns
  • Experience supporting new business activity and growing client relationships
  • Confidence working with senior stakeholders and navigating complex or sensitive situations
  • Proven ability to mentor and support team members
  • Good commercial awareness and understanding of account performance
  • A proactive, solutions-focused mindset
